X-SVN-Group: stable-10 M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it X-BeenThere: svn-src-stable-10@freebsd.org X-Mailman-Version: 2.1.17 Precedence: list List-Id: SVN commit messages for only the 10-stable src tree List-Unsubscribe: , List-Archive: List-Post: List-Help: List-Subscribe: , X-List-Received-Date: Tue, 04 Feb 2014 03:36:52 -0000 Author: eadler Date: Tue Feb 4 03:36:42 2014 New Revision: 261455 URL: http://svnweb.freebsd.org/changeset/base/261455 Log: MFC r258779,r258780,r258787,r258822: Fix undefined behavior: (1 << 31) is not defined as 1 is an int and this shifts into the sign bit. Instead use (1U << 31) which gets the expected result. Similar to the (1 << 31) case it is not defined to do (2 << 30). This fix is not ideal as it assumes a 32 bit int, but does fix the issue for most cases. A similar change was made in OpenBSD.
